Round Andros ceiling light with a natural design The Andros collection from the sustainable brand GOOD & MOJO is a fusion of craftsmanship and the sea. Inspired by the calm waves and sandy beaches of the island of the same name, the beautifully designed Andros ceiling light is an inspiring and responsible choice of lighting. It emits a soft, warm light everywhere and impresses with its natural design. Every single piece is manufactured with sustainability in mind. The fine, differently coloured patterns that form the round ceiling lamp create an appealing pattern of light and shadow. Andros is made from seagrass, which thrives in global ocean waters and forms the largest ecosystem in the Bahamas. It is renewable, fast-growing and requires no fertilisers or pesticides. Seagrass meadows are also an incredible carbon store.
